Publisher Description:
This book shows how cities are contributing much more to economic development than the rest of the country. In particular the middle size towns in China and India still have a huge potential to absorb migrants and contribute to economic growth. In China the biggest cities tend to grow slower, probably because environmental, traffic and problems of administration tend to increase. In India these cities still benefit from the cheap labour going there. Both countries would benefit from developing their urban innovative milieu, because future growth will require new technologies, new products and new ways of dealing with urban issues.
